Команда eComCharge запустила систему поиска и отображения серверных логов процессинга транзакций для своих клиентов: у каждого PSP, работающего на платформе beGateway, в личном кабинете появился журнал запросов и ответов между арендуемой им процессинговой системой и банками-эквайерами, с которыми он работает.

Логи транзакций

«Каждый наш клиент получил возможность в личном кабинете арендуемой им системы приема и обработки интернет платежей посмотреть логи коммуникаций между процессинговой системой и банками-эквайерами по интересующим его транзакциям, без обращения в нашу службу технической поддержки», — комментирует Александр Михайловский, директор по развитию еComCharge UAB.

Что такое логи транзакций?

Лог – это информация о каком-то событии, записанная в хронологическом порядке, из которой видно, с чего все начиналось и чем все закончилось.

Любое взаимодействие процессинговой системы с банком-эквайером, состоит из цепочки запросов и ответов между сервером процессинговой системы, сервером платежного шлюза банка-эквайера и очень часто – с серверами сторонних информационных систем.

логи транзакций в платформе обработки платежей

Все начинается с инициирующего запроса процессинговой системы к платежному шлюзу банка-эквайера. В ходе этого и последующих запросов и ответов, серверы обмениваются транзакционными и служебными данными, необходимыми для совершения платежа, его отмены или любого иного действия, предусмотренного протоколом взаимодействия.

В процессе обработки транзакции могут случаться запросы к информационным системам третьих сторон, например, для проверки плательщика по протоколу 3 d secure, проводки транзакции через систему управления рисками или систему маршрутизации для выбора нужного платежного шлюза. В ходе всех этих запросов и ответов происходит обмен данными и каждое действие записывается в серверный лог (журнал событий). В любой момент из этого лога можно увидеть куда и когда был отправлен запрос, из чего он состоял, чем завершился, когда и какой ответ был получен.

Возможность просматривать журнал серверных событий очень важна, — добавляет эксперт. Любая транзакция, которая не завершилась успехом – это недополученная выручка для торговца и недополученная прибыль для поставщика платежных услуг, который его обслуживает. Сам процесс обработки транзакции – это хоть и быстрый, но довольно сложный процесс, в который вовлечены 2, 3 и больше участников. Если транзакция зависает в незавершенных или оканчивается неуспехом, очень важно иметь возможность быстро установить, что именно привело к такому результату, и при необходимости, как можно скорее предпринять шаги для устранения этой причины.

Например, бывают ситуации, когда транзакция была инициирована, но конечного статуса так и не получила, «зависнув» в статусе ожидания завершения. Без доступа к серверным логам все, что видит сотрудник PSP в своем личном кабинете – это то, что транзакция находится в статусе «pending». Но почему она находится в этом статусе – не понятно. Возможно, плательщик ушел на проверку по протоколу 3-D Secure и не вернулся. Такое иногда случается, и, хотя это не приятно, никаких действий со стороны PSP предпринимать не требуется. А может быть что-то пошло не так на стороне платежного шлюза банка-эквайера или еще где-то, и требуется немедленное обращение в техническую поддержку партнера для устранения сбоя. Только серверные логи могут показать всю картинку произошедшего и помочь разобраться в причинах возникшей проблемы».

логи транзакций

До введения нового функционала доступ к серверным логам имела только команда eComCharge, как владелец платформы beGateway. Это было обусловлено тем, что в облачной платформе beGateway хранение всех логов было организовано централизованно в одной базе данных, при этом разграничения доступа к логам разных экземпляров процессинговых системы на платформе отсутствовало. Предоставление доступа к логам одному клиенту означало бы получение им доступа к логам всех процессинговых системы, построенных на платформе beGateway. Поэтому, каждый раз, когда любому арендатору платформы нужно было понять, что произошло с транзакцией, он должен был обращаться в круглосуточную техподдержку eComCharge.

Какие обновления произошли в beGateway

«Мы изменили подходы к хранению и поиску логов транзакций в базе данных. Существенно ускорили ее работу. Создали систему доступа к логам, позволяющую давать доступ на нужном уровне, например на уровне PSP или на уровне отдельного торговца. Как результат, теперь хранилище логов платформы beGateway способно работать с огромным массивом информации, быстро осуществлять поиск нужных данных и отдавать логи только того клиента, который делает запрос», — поясняет Александр Михайловский.

Благодаря этому, сегодня каждый арендатор платформы beGateway имеет возможность самостоятельно в своем личном кабинете посмотреть все логи транзакций между своей процессинговой системой и банками-эквайерами, с которыми он работает, по интересующим его транзакциям без обращения в нашу службу технической поддержки, что в свою очередь положительно сказывается на скорость реакции нашего клиента на запросы своих клиентов и на возможные инциденты с обработкой транзакций.

Если у вас нет собственного платежного шлюза или думаете поменять поставщика услуг, возьмите в аренду наш beGateway!

Respectfully, eComCharge TeamВерим в ваш успех, Команда eComCharge
eComCharge develops and delivers the PCI DSS Level 1 certified White Label Payment Platform beGateway for Payment Service Providers and Acquirers.Компания eComCharge разрабатывает и поставляет процессинговую платежную платформу beGateway, сертифицированную по самому высшему уровню стандарта PCI DSS, для поставщиков платежных услуг и банков, которые используют ее под собственным брендом.